Revolutionizing the PR Industry

There are a lot of changes that are currently taking place in the business PR industry. The overall reason behind this is that the focus areas are changing, but in order to make that happen, there are plenty of small changes that need to happen first. However, the PR industry doesn’t just function on one thing. There are multiple areas in the PR industry, and when businesses chose to launch a campaign, they normally have to choose one of the three: Traditional PR, Social Media or Advocacy PR. More and more companies have been focusing on reaching out to the people through social media, while traditional PR is slowly starting to diminish. As for Advocacy PR, it’s still existent and rather important.

How can companies measure the success of their marketing efforts?

Measure marketing success through a combination of metrics including customer acquisition cost, conversion rates, return on ad spend, website traffic growth, lead quality, brand awareness surveys, social media engagement, and ultimately revenue attributed to marketing activities. Use attribution modeling to understand how multiple channels work together.

What are common mistakes businesses make with their marketing?

Common marketing mistakes include targeting too broad an audience, inconsistent brand messaging, neglecting data and analytics, copying competitors instead of differentiating, underinvesting in content quality, ignoring customer retention in favor of acquisition, and failing to adapt strategies based on performance data. Strategic focus and consistency outperform scattered tactical efforts.
